AUTODOME & MIC cameras – Privacy mask moves when zooming IN & OUT

Possible causes and solution(s)


Solution

Note: This experienced behavior is not caused by a wrong usage or defect, but result of a not optimal factory calibration.
Note: Before start, it might be handy to activate "crosshairs", not all camera models have this. For example you can activate this on a MIC9000i (see below), but not on a AUTODOME IP starlight 5000i IR

In the attached example video we used:

  • AUTODOME IP starlight 5000i IR
  • FW 7.81.0060

First step is to calibrate the camera:

  1. Reboot the camera first
  2. Zoom in to a good recognizable place
  3. Issue AUX ON 804 > move gray dot to a calibration target (at least 3m from cam)
  4. Issue AUX ON 804 again > cam zooms out to 1x, if dot has moved use PTZ to move it back to the calibration target (you may want to use full and big screen)
  5. Issue AUX OFF 804 > calibration finished

Next step is to properly draw the mask(s):

  1. First zoom in as close as possible on the target that you intend to cover
  2. Now enable the mask of choose, a rectangle box appears, shape this according the target
  3. Always draw the mask bit larger than the object you like to mask
  4. Choose 1 larger mask, above multiple tiny ones, in case this is possible
  5. Enable "mask enlargement"
